I recall that people were asking for a "fuzzy" clock applet for the GNOME panel, it being something in KDE that GNOME lacked, and I really missed. Coincidentally, I also needed to learn to use PyGTK.
So I made one + an installer script. :)
You can also run it manually in a window with
$ python ./FuzzClock.py --in-window
I hope some people will find this useful either in the transition from KDE or just for the heck of it. Constructive suggestions/bug reports are welcome. I'm sure there's at least a few things I could do to make it better.
http://code.google.com/p/fuzzy-clock/
As of 1.0.3, I've added a proper README, clarified the installer script, and made 12 hour mode the default mode, as per requests.
